Output ef9676a4e31b0cf7954aa0c665daeebe1ff0b7d58cabb5f7ac42e68285606694:20

value
1630939
script pubkey
OP_0 OP_PUSHBYTES_20 599e85c552e8e296449ca4557ca2c94ec1b6fa22
address
ltc1qtx0gt32jar3fv3yu532hegkffmqmd73zq0d6ja
transaction
ef9676a4e31b0cf7954aa0c665daeebe1ff0b7d58cabb5f7ac42e68285606694
spent
true